Easy food processor banana bread recipe details
- Ingredients:
- 1/2 cup walnuts
- 3 medium bananas (very ripe)
- 1 cup sugar
- 2 eggs
- 1/2 cup vegetable oil
- 1/2 teaspoon vanilla
- 1-1/2 cups flour
- 1/2 teaspoon baking soda
- 1 teaspoon baking powder
- 1/4 teaspoon salt
Oil sides and bottom of a 9 x 5 x 3-inch loaf pan. Preheat oven to 350 degrees.
With steel knife, process bananas to a smooth puree. Add sugar and eggs. Process 15 seconds. With motor running, add oil through the tube. Remove cover, scrape down the sides, add vanilla and dry ingredients. Turn motor on and off several times. Do not over process. Open and drop in nuts. Process quickly with on/off turns to chop the nuts a little. Turn batter into pan and bake for 1 hour until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ean. Let cool in pan for 10 minutes, then out on a cake rack to cool completely.
